Crooks and Liars: Vernon Robinson's sick commercial

Crooks and Liars has the video of a real spot for a wacko running for Congress in North Carolina. God help us.


At 9:13 AM, Blogger Tarheel Dem said...

Hope you will consider signing on to help Brad Miller, the incumbent in the race. You can learn more about Brad at his website or at his diary at DailyKos.


